精品为您呈现,快乐和您分享!

移动端

收藏本站

OK下载站

当前位置: 首页 > 软件下载 > 编程开发

ScheduleMaster(分布式任务调度系统)v2.2官方版

ScheduleMaster(分布式任务调度系统)v2.2官方版

类型:编程开发 语言:简体

大小:7.7M 更新时间:2021-05-12

推荐指数:

应用简介


ScheduleMaster是一个开源的分布式任务调度系统。它基于.NETCore3.1平台构建,支持跨平台多节点部署和运行。调度类型丰富,系统参数灵活可控,UI操作简单,支持多节点高速运行。可用、业务API集成等功能。









ScheduleMaster是一个开源的分布式任务调度系统。它基于.NET Core 3.1平台构建,支持跨平台多节点部署和运行。调度类型丰富,系统参数灵活可控,UI操作简单,支持多节点高速部署。可用、业务API集成等功能。



ScheduleMaster(分布式任务调度系统)



软件特点



简单的Web UI操作;



动态任务管理:创建、启动、停止、暂停、恢复、删除等;



高可用性支持,跨平台多节点部署。



数据安全,不会有多个实例并发调度。



支持自定义参数设置;



支持.NET Core和.net框架(4.6.1+);



支持自定义配置文件和热更新;



支持设置监护人,操作异常时发送邮件提醒;



支持设置任务依赖关系、自动触发、共享任务结果;



插件开发、任务运行环境隔离;



全链路日志系统,轻松掌控运行轨迹;



用户访问控制;



提供开放的REST API,以便业务系统无缝集成;



调度报表统计;



任务组管理;



拆分日程,实现复用;



指定要运行的节点;



支持http任务配置;



支持延迟任务;



任务监控;



资源监控;



支持异常策略配置(失败重试、超时控制等);



访问redis缓存;



支持多种数据库类型;



用户权限更加细化;



报表统计完善;



指示



在Windows 中运行



找到master的release目录,执行命令dotnet Hos.ScheduleMaster.Web.dll启动程序。首次启动会自动迁移并生成数据库结构并初始化种子数据。只需打开浏览器输入IP和端口即可访问(初始用户名admin,密码111111 )。



找到worker的release目录,执行命令dotnet Hos.ScheduleMaster.Qu artzHost.dll --urls http://*:30001启动程序。打开浏览器并输入IP和端口。你会看到一个欢迎页面,表明worker已经成功启动。



修改worker下的appsettings.json文件为worker2的配置(发布前修改过的可以跳过),执行命令dotnet Hos.ScheduleMaster.QuartzHost.dll --urls http://*:30002 启动该程序。



登录master,在节点管理菜单下可以看到各个节点的运行状态。



变更日志



v2.2



支持sqlserver和postgresql



支持网络标准2.0



添加最大并发worker数量



添加http任务超时



修复了一些错误